After-market parts are produced by manufacturers other than the original equipment manufacturer (OEM). This distinction is important in the automotive and machinery industries, where after-market parts serve as alternatives to OEM parts. These parts are designed to fit and function similarly to the original ones but are not made by the original manufacturer.

Understanding after-market parts helps in recognizing their potential benefits, such as often lower costs and greater availability compared to OEM parts. However, it's also essential to evaluate their quality and compatibility, as these can vary widely among different after-market manufacturers. After-market parts can provide viable options for consumers, depending on their needs and budget, which is why this statement accurately describes their defining characteristic.
